Ashes of the Middle East : how empires and oil consumed a civilization from Afghanistan to the Maghreb / Hardev Panesar.

Summary: A historical and geopolitical analysis of the Middle East and North Africa region, examining the impact of imperial powers, resource exploitation, particularly oil, and political conflicts from Afghanistan through the Levant to the Maghreb.
